    Abstract: A tire picking system (100) performs a process for picking one or more tires stored in an unknown arrangement and for which a target location must be realized. A gripper (108) and a robot (102) including a gripping device (104) supported by a pivotable elongated arm (106), the gripping device extending from the elongated arm to a free end (104a) where the gripper is disposed, form part of the system (100). An image processing module applies data representative of the physical environment around the robot (102) to a deployed neural network in order to determine one or more parameters of a target tire (P*); the robot is set in motion based on the determined parameters of the target tire, so that the gripper can pick a target tire (P*) selected by the system (100) from among the stored tires.

    Abstract: A method of laying elastomeric elements using a facility including a drum for manufacturing tire blanks and at least one collaborative robotized arm equipped with at least one effector. A stage of laying an elastomeric element includes a predetermined sequence of steps. The sequence comprises the steps of grasping and drawing the elastomeric element towards the drum using the robotized arm. The laying of elastomeric elements includes instructions which can be executed by the processor of a control unit in order to implement. The sequence includes a stage of automatic performance of a step according to the sequence. The sequence also includes a stage of interruption of the sequence. The sequence further includes a stage of manual performance of the interrupted step or the next step according to the sequence.

    Abstract: A process for directing the movement of a robot (102) with a gripper (108) that picks a target tire (P*) from an arrangement of tires includes the following steps: providing a system (100) for picking one or more tires stored in the arrangement of tires, the robot forming part of this system; determining one or more parameters of the target tire in the arrangement of tires; determining the diameter of the target tire; determining the tire radius (RP) and the rim radius (RJ) of the target tire; an approaching step whereby the robot approaches the target tire identified for picking; a picking step whereby the target tire is picked by the gripper; and extracting the target tire from the arrangement of tires in order to place it in a target location.
